I am trying to build sensors 2.8.3 and it fails with:
make: *** No rule to make target `mach_mpspec.h', needed by `kernel/chips/vt1211.d'. Stop.
There is no mach_mpspec.h in include/linux nor include/linux/asm in the kernel
tree (I use 2.6.2-rc1-mm3). It is not included directly by sensors, but for
example, mpspec.h reads:
werewolf:/usr/src/linux/include/asm# grep mach_mpspec.h *
mpspec.h:#include <mach_mpspec.h>
all mach_mpspec.h are inside subarch dirs in include/asm (for example,
include/asm/mach-default/).
Workaround is to add -I/usr/src/linux/include/asm/mach-default.
But should not the contents be symlinked for the proper subarch ? IE
/usr/src/linux/include/asm/mach_mpspec.h -> mach-default/mach_mpspec.h
